Russian enclave Kaliningrad volume up 14.6pc to 360,000 TEU in 2012

CONTAINER trade through Russia's Port of Kaliningrad during 2012 increased by 14.6 per cent year on year to 360,000 TEU while overall cargo volume dropped 7.5 per cent to 12.4 million tons, reports Gdynia's Baltic Transport Journal.

Most containers through Kaliningrad were destined for local automotive industry while 10 per cent of all cargo went to mainland Russia.
